We are searching for the best talent for a Regional Business Director, Hematology covering the Northeast Region.
This is a field-based role available in all cities within the Northeast. While specific states are listed in the Locations section for reference, please note that they are examples only and do not limit your application. We invite candidates from any location within the region to apply.
Purpose
The Regional Business Director, Hematology (Northeast), is a field-based leadership position and is accountable for effectively leading and developing a team of District Managers (DMs) and Sales Specialists who have sales responsibilities for the Hematology portfolio, including DARZALEX, TECVAYLI and TALVEY across Johnson & Johnson accounts, while also working with a wide range of cross-disciplinary partners in the Northeast.
Key Responsibilities
  • Lead, motivate, mentor, develop, and retain a high-performance team of District Managers and Sales Specialists with varied strengths who are technically competent and skilled in the Johnson & Johnson oncology business, the healthcare marketplace, and account management.
  • Develop and execute an aligned business plan, customized to meet the needs of Johnson & Johnson business and brand strategies, that delivers compliant product sales growth that will meet or exceed Hematology portfolio objectives while effectively addressing the unique needs and requirements of the customer and the marketplace.
  • Analyze sales and operations data across the Hematology portfolio to monitor performance, identify drivers and barriers, prioritize opportunities, and develop corrective plans that secure and apply resources to improve team results and sales force effectiveness and efficiency.
  • Collaborate extensively at all organizational levels with key internal partners (i.e. Sales Leadership, Key Accounts, Hematology Clinical Educators, Field Reimbursement, Area Business Specialists, Brand, Strategic Customer Group, Commercial Excellence, etc.) as well as external partners to develop optimal access and establish relationships and effective operating networks to facilitate positive business interactions.
  • Coach others to effectively convince internal and external partners to build mutual alignment, embrace difficult positions, and achieve outcomes that are both customer-centric and company responsible.
  • Set overall account goals and objectives, and lead development and provide oversight of account metrics and business performance.
  • Fostering an environment where new ideas, alternative strategies and innovative thinking are valued and explored, while remaining compliant to Company standards.
  • All responsibilities of the Regional Business Director are carried out with strict adherence to the J&J Credo and HCC guidelines.

The anticipated base pay range for this position is $162,000 - $279,450.
The Company maintains highly competitive, performance-based compensation programs. Under current guidelines, this position is eligible for an annual performance bonus in accordance with the terms of the applicable plan. The annual performance bonus is a cash bonus intended to provide an incentive to achieve annual targeted results by rewarding for individual and the corporation’s performance over a calendar/performance year. Bonuses are awarded at the Company’s discretion on an individual basis.
  • Employees and/or eligible dependents may be eligible to participate in the following Company sponsored employee benefit programs: medical, dental, vision, life insurance, short- and long-term disability, business accident insurance, and group legal insurance.
  • Employees may be eligible to participate in the Company’s consolidated retirement plan (pension) and savings plan (401(k)).
  • This position is eligible to participate in the Company’s long-term incentive program.
  • Employees are eligible for the following time off benefits:
– Vacation – up to 120 hours per calendar year
– Sick time - up to 40 hours per calendar year; for employees who reside in the State of Washington – up to 56 hours per calendar
